Before getting started with the installation
process, it’s crucial to understand what a magnetic contactor is and how it
functions. A magnetic contactor is an
electrically handled switch used for switching an electrical power circuit. Unlike manual
switches, magnetic contactors can be operated remotely, allowing for greater
flexibility and automation in managing electrical loads.
Key Components of a Magnetic Contactor
● Electromagnet (Coil): Generates a magnetic field when energised.
● Contacts: Moveable
and stationary parts that open or close the circuit.
● Arc Suppression: Minimises the arc produced when the contacts open or close.

Testing and Commissioning
● Initial Test: Energise the control circuit, observing the contactor’s operation,
ensuring it pulls in when energised and releases correctly when de-energised
for proper function.
● Load Test: Apply
power to the load circuit and observe the operation under load conditions.
Check for any indications of overheating or unusual noises, which may indicate
improper connections or a faulty contactor.
● Final Checks: Run the system through several cycles to ensure reliable operation.
Visually inspect the contactor and surrounding wiring for any signs of wear or
damage.
Maintenance Tips
● Regular Inspections: Regularly inspect the contactor for signs of wear, corrosion, or
damage. Periodically check and tighten all electrical connections.
● Cleaning: Keep
the contactor and surrounding area clean and free of dust and debris. If
necessary, clean the contacts using a contact cleaner to remove oxidation and
ensure good conductivity.
● Testing:
Periodically test the contactor’s operation using a multimeter to check for
proper resistance and operation.
